门诊区域人工及智能静脉采血的安全性评价及成本效益分析

摘要: 目的:对比分析门诊区域人工及智能静脉采血的安全性及成本效益。方法:以A院区人工静脉采血为对照,B院区实施智能静脉采血,收集样本院区2022年1月—12月财务和商务智能集成平台数据,通过现场调查法及项目成本法,测算并分析人工与智能静脉采血项目的作业时间、血标本质量、成本收益与服务效能的差别。结果:与人工静脉采血相比,智能静脉采血的登记作业时间[(10.83±4.54)秒vs(31.68±14.36)秒]、整理作业时间[(3.78±1.28)秒vs(12.60±10.12)秒]及总作业时间[(61.34±17.79)秒vs(90.54±37.20)秒]更短,项目总成本更高[(26.77± 4.93)元/例vs(23.95±4.72)元/例],人力成本更低[(4.76±0.20)元/例vs(5.71±0.35)元/例],差异均有统计学意义(P<0.05)。人工采血的条码、留取及送检问题发生率均高于智能静脉采血,应用智能静脉采血系统的护士岗位服务效能高达112.07%,人工与智能静脉采血成本收益均为负收益。结论:智能静脉采血流程更加优化,作业时间缩短,血标本质量问题发生率更低,护理岗位服务效能更高。但现行静脉采血收费标准低于实际作业成本,建议适当提高静脉采血项目的收费标准,实现技术劳务价值为主的正向激励机制。

关键词: 静脉采血;智能采血;成本收益;血标本质量;服务效能;护理安全

Abstract: Objective: To compare and evaluate the safety and cost-benefit of the manual and intelligent venous blood collection in outpatient area. Methods: The hospital selected had two branches with the outpatient area in Branch A using manual venous blood sampling as the control group and the outpatient area in Branch B using intelligent venous blood sampling as the experimental group. From January to December 2022, both the financial data and data collected from the Business Intelligence (BI) integration platform were calculated and analyzed to test the differences between manual and intelligent venous blood sampling in terms of operation time, safety quality, cost-benefit and service efficiency through on-site investigation, insider interview and project cost method. Results: Compared with manual venous blood sampling, the registration [(10.83±4.54) s vs (31.68±14.36) s], sorting [(3.78±1.28) s vs (12.60±10.12) s] and total time of intelligent venous blood collection [(61.34±17.79) s vs (90.54±37.20) s] were less, the total cost of the project was higher [(26.77±4.93) yuan/case vs (23.95±4.72) yuan/case], the labor cost was lower [(4.76±0.20) yuan/case vs (5.71±0.35) yuan/case], and the differences were statistically significant (P<0.05). The rate of barcode, collection and submission quality problems of manual blood sampling is higher than that of intelligent blood sampling, the service efficiency of nurses applying intelligent venous blood sampling system was as high as 112.07%, and the cost-benefit of both venous blood sampling methods were negative. Conclusion: Intelligent venous blood sampling project is more optimized with shorter operation time, less blood sample quality problems and higher nursing service efficiency. However, the current charging standard is lower than the cost of venous blood sampling. It is thus suggested to appropriately increase the charging standard of venous blood sampling to promote a positive incentive mechanism focusing on realizing the value of technical services.
